Treating HIV

Treating the HIV infection is a big step. Plan ahead. It is the best way for you to manage HIV over time. Talk with your healthcare provider about when to start treatment and what medicines to take first. Think carefully before you start treatment.

When you decide to start treatment, you鈥檒l need a plan to help you control the infection for years to come. Talk with your healthcare provider. Ask about the long-term effects that the medicines you take today could have on your future health. He or she will need to take a look at your overall health needs in order to help you choose an HIV treatment.

Factors to consider

In helping you choose an HIV treatment, your provider will look at your:

CD4 cell count: HIV attacks these cells and uses them to make more copies of the virus. When this happens, the CD4 cell can鈥檛 help the body fight infection as well. A normal CD4 count is between 500 and 1,600 cells/mm3.
Past and current health
How ready you are to treat your HIV infection and follow treatment instructions
Emotional health
